Before visiting in October 2017, I wrote in another review that for some reason, there are very few tonkatsu and tempura specialty shops in Otaru. When it comes to fried food, it's not like Otaru folks go for "Naruto" chicken half-fried... but what do the people of Otaru do when they want to eat tonkatsu? Such a silly question (lol). In the midst of this, a new tonkatsu specialty shop has opened called "Uminoya." The location is in the direction of Hanazono Street from JR Minami-Otaru Station, a little north on Hanazono Green Road. It was originally a cafe, so the interior is in a state close to being a sublease. As a result, the tables and seats are low and somewhat uncomfortable, with a feeling of needing to upgrade the seating to be more suitable for dining. The menu includes tonkatsu set meals, various fried dishes, hamburg steak, ginger grilled meat, and other items, so there is a wide variety despite being a tonkatsu specialty shop, and of course they also offer katsudon and katsu curry. This time, I had the classic "Rosu Katsu Set Meal," which comes with a 110g pork loin cutlet, rice, miso soup, and pickles. When you hear 110g, it may seem a bit lacking, but in reality, it has a decent amount of volume and is quite satisfying. Additionally, if you choose the premium loin, it comes with a 150g cutlet, so it's good to choose based on your appetite. One thing that slightly bothered me was that compared to tonkatsu specialty shops in Sapporo, there was a general feeling of dissatisfaction in various aspects. The issue with the customer seating tables mentioned earlier is one example, and there were other points where I felt a bit lacking, such as the use of tableware and table condiments. I gave a slightly strict rating with expectations, but it is also a shop that I look forward to in the future.
